This repository provides C++ implementations for C-SA (Coded Slotted ALOHA) system over Rayleigh fading channels.
- Monte Carlo Simulation
- Density Evolution

The parameters in these source codes are as follows:
Simulation
- ite : # of fading samples
- SNR : average received SNR per device (dB)
- M : M+1 collisions wihtin a slot
- K : # of message segments
- trans : transmission packets per slot
Analysis
- SNR : average received SNR per device (dB)
- M : M+1 collisions wihtin a slot
- IS : # of message segments

Simulation
Here's how you'd run these codes:
g++ -o csa c-sa_simulation_main.cpp
./csa 10000 dist.txt
The first input is the number of slots, and the second input file is the degree distribution.
